Reliable data intelligence depends on consistency. Whether teams are tracking competitors, monitoring markets, or feeding analytics pipelines, unreliable access quickly undermines decision-making. This is why many organizations rely on bulk proxy pools to support dependable, large-scale data intelligence operations.
By distributing traffic across large sets of datacenter IPs, bulk proxy pools provide the stability, coverage, and cost control required for continuous data-driven insight.
Data intelligence refers to the process of collecting, aggregating, and analyzing external data to inform business decisions.
